It was December 2, 2017 when a house filled with smoke in Guthrie. The two people inside were able to escape, thanks to smoke alarms installed just three months prior by the Oklahoma Assistive Technology Foundation (OkAT) AFG grant and Nick Mueller, OSU Fire Protection alumnus.

Originally from Colorado, Mueller came to OSU after taking a concurrent enrolment fire science class during his senior year of high school. This sparked his interest in this field of study and career path. After hearing high praise from professionals about OSU’s Fire Protection and Safety Technology program, Mueller enrolled.

As a student, Mueller worked at Fire Protection Publications as a student smoke alarm installer.

My most prominent role was installing smoke alarms in the homes of those with disabilities whom applied and were accepted by the OkAT smoke alarm program,” said Mueller, adding “The equipment installed includes single station smoke alarms and a bed shaker alert device.

This was the equipment he installed in a Guthrie home in September 2017. The consumer had low vision and mobility impairment. The smoke alarms Mueller installed alerted her and her caregiver to a fire in December 2017. They escaped unharmed.
